The experience was not a good one. They said they were going to do it in December (and) it would be done before the end of the month before it snowed and everything. They never came until way, way, way to almost the end of January. They said the snow guards they brought were not long enough and they would have to get longer ones. Then they had gone on the roof (and) cracked the tile. They said they were going to fix it (and) they had to get another tile. Then they said they got to order the things and then they called me up a couple of days later and they said he could not get those things. I said everybody has the same kind of roof. He told me he could not get the long ones so he would have to refund me the money. I said well then they would have to come back and fix the roof. He said the guy said they did it. I said it looked like there was still a crack and I wanted them to come and check it. All of a sudden and I am waiting weeks and I don't get any check. So I called and they said they mailed it and I should have gotten it a long time ago. Then I said they ought to cancel the check and send me another one. Then the guy said he still was going to come and look at the roof. He still hasn't come, but I did get the check from my deposit back. So this is a three month thing and I am not happy. The price would have been $850 and I gave them half, $425. I would never recommend them. I mean, he is a nice guy and if they would have had the things, but he told me don't worry about it and he could do this. Every time he tells me he is coming he doesn't come. I don't know when they are coming. (They are) not reliable. I would never use them again. The price seemed fair. They sounded good, but they never did what they said.
